Fragrance-free Environment Procedure
A fragrance-free environment helps create a safe and healthy workplace. Fragrances from personal care products, air fresheners, candles and cleaning products have been associated with adversely affecting a person’s health including headaches, upper respiratory symptoms, shortness of breath, and difficulty with concentration. People with allergies and asthma report that certain odors, even in small amounts, can cause asthma symptoms. The Acton School Department will work with building management to ensure that products used to clean the workplace are fragrance-free and follow best practices to limit employee exposure to cleaning chemicals. The Acton School Department recognizes the hazards caused by exposure to scented products and cleaning chemicals and we have a policy to provide a fragrance-free environment for all employees and visitors to keep a safe and healthy workplace environment. This policy applies to both employees and non-employee visitors of the Acton School Department.
Procedure
1. Employees will be informed of the Acton School Department Fragrance-free Policy through signs posted throughout properties owned and operated by the Acton School Department including company-owned vehicles.
2. Visitors will be informed of the Acton School Department Fragrance-free Policy by their hosts, the meeting invite, email correspondences and signs posted throughout the properties owned and operated by the Acton School Department.
Sample Email Signature for guests: “This is a fragrance-free workplace. Thank you for not wearing any of the following during your visit: cologne, after shave lotion, perfume, perfumed hand lotion, fragranced hair products, and/or similar products. Our chemically-sensitive coworkers and clients thank you.”
3. Any violations of this policy will be handled through the standard disciplinary procedure.
